Inhibin B
A hormone made by the ovaries in women and by the sperm-supporting cells of the testes in men. It reflects how well those tissues are working — used mainly to help assess ovarian reserve in fertility work-up and, in men, testicular sperm production, always read alongside FSH.
What it measures
Inhibin B is a hormone produced by the granulosa cells of the ovary in women and by the Sertoli cells of the testis in men. Its job is to give feedback to the pituitary gland, damping down the release of FSH — so inhibin B and FSH move in opposite directions and are best read together. In women, inhibin B is made by the pool of small growing follicles, so its level reflects ovarian reserve — the number of eggs remaining. As a woman ages and that pool shrinks, inhibin B falls and FSH rises, a pattern seen in diminished ovarian reserve and around the menopause. It is one of several markers (with AMH and FSH) used in fertility assessment, though AMH has largely become the preferred, more stable measure of reserve. In men, inhibin B reflects the health of the sperm-producing tissue: a good level suggests active spermatogenesis, while a low level with a high FSH points to testicular failure. It is also used in monitoring certain ovarian tumours (granulosa cell tumours), which can secrete it. Because it varies so much with sex, menstrual cycle phase and age, inhibin B is always interpreted in context rather than against a single number.
What a high value can mean
- A granulosa cell tumour of the ovary — these can secrete inhibin B, which is used as a tumour marker to monitor them.
- A good pool of growing follicles — in the fertility context, a higher level reflects better ovarian reserve.
- Active testicular function in men — a healthy level supports normal sperm production.
What a low value can mean
- Diminished ovarian reserve — fewer remaining eggs; inhibin B falls as FSH rises.
- Approaching or established menopause — the ovarian pool is depleting.
- Testicular failure in men — low inhibin B with a high FSH suggests impaired sperm production.
- Suppression of the pituitary–gonadal axis — from certain hormonal states or treatments.
When to discuss with a doctor
Inhibin B is a specialist fertility and reproductive test rather than a routine one. In women, it is used as part of assessing ovarian reserve during a fertility work-up, always alongside FSH and usually AMH, which together give a fuller picture than any single value. In men, a low inhibin B with a raised FSH supports impaired sperm production. It is also followed as a tumour marker in granulosa cell tumours of the ovary. Because inhibin B swings widely with cycle phase, age and sex, one value in isolation means little.
